Media advisory - Royal Canadian Mint to unveil fine silver coin commemorating 50th anniversary of Canadian Coast Guard Français
OTTAWA, July 11, 2012 /CNW/ - The Royal Canadian Mint will unveil a fine silver coin commemorating the 50th anniversary of the Canadian Coast Guard.

About the Royal Canadian Mint
The Royal Canadian Mint is the Crown Corporation responsible for the minting and distribution of Canada's circulation coins. An ISO 9001-2008 certified company, the Mint is recognized as one of the largest and most versatile mints in the world, offering a wide range of specialized, high quality coinage products and related services on an international scale.
